- [ ] **Step 7: Breaker override escrow.** After sealing the signing keys for the Tallgrove upstream API circuit breaker, confirm the support team can force the breaker open during a full outage. The override bundle lives in the sealed escrow drawer and is useless without its unlock phrase. Two ceremony witnesses must initial this step before proceeding. The escrow bundle is decrypted with the recovery passphrase that follows.

vault phrase of kahip-kahop = holath-quenmir

# Break-Glass: Catalog Cache Invalidation

Scope: the Pinrow product catalog at Veldstone Retail. If stale prices persist after a purge and the Hollowmere invalidation queue is wedged, use break-glass to flush the edge tier directly. Contractors: get verbal sign-off from the catalog lead first. Steps: open the Hollowmere admin shell, select emergency-flush, confirm the tenant, and run it once — repeated flushes thrash the origin. Access is logged and expires after 20 minutes. Unseal the admin shell with the passphrase below.

recovery phrase for kahop-tajog: istix-casvan

Partition maintenance — Shardline plugins. Tables in the metrics schema are partitioned by month; new partitions are created on the 25th by the rollover job. Plugins must never write to future partitions directly. Query via the router endpoint only. To register your plugin with the rollover notifier, authenticate using the key below.

service key, fawip-bajef: kto11_Qt5wZK9vdNC